Calculating the Rate Per Km is essential in various contexts, such as logistics, travel planning, and budget management. This metric helps in understanding the cost efficiency of transportation over a distance, enabling better decision-making.

Historical Background

The concept of calculating costs per unit distance has been a fundamental aspect of trade and transportation throughout history. It allows for the comparison of different transportation methods and routes, optimizing for cost, time, and resource allocation.

Calculation Formula

The formula to calculate the Rate Per Km is given by:

\[ RKM = \frac{C}{D} \]

where:

  • \(RKM\) is the Rate Per Km ($/km),
  • \(C\) is the total cost ($),
  • \(D\) is the total distance (km).

Example Calculation

If the total cost for a delivery is $150 and the distance covered is 300 km, the Rate Per Km is calculated as:

\[ RKM = \frac{150}{300} = 0.5 \text{ $/km} \]

Importance and Usage Scenarios

Understanding the Rate Per Km is crucial for budgeting in logistics, personal travel, and service pricing. It helps in evaluating the cost-effectiveness of different transportation options and in planning for cost reductions.

Common FAQs

  1. What does the Rate Per Km tell you?

    • It provides a clear metric of the cost to travel or transport goods over one kilometer, aiding in financial planning and efficiency assessments.
  2. How can I reduce the Rate Per Km?

    • Reducing the total cost through more efficient routes or vehicles, or increasing the total distance covered under the same cost can lower the Rate Per Km.
  3. Is the Rate Per Km applicable only to road transportation?

    • No, it's a versatile metric applicable to any mode of transportation where costs and distances can be measured, including air, sea, and rail.
